Billy Tang to helm new London nonprofit

Billy Tang has been appointed artistic director of Yan Du Project, a new nonprofit space in London opened by the eponymous collector.

Tang was previously at Para Site in Hong Kong, where he served as executive director for three years. Prior to that, he held curatorial roles at Shanghai’s Rockbund Art Museum and Beijing’s Magician Space.

‘Having worked across a spectrum of institutional structures worldwide,’ Tang told ARTnews, ‘I am driven by the desire to come full circle, bringing my hard-won experience back to the city that has been a profound source of inspiration for me as both a curator and a Londoner.’

Yan Du Project, dedicated to Asian and Asian diasporic artists, opens to the public on 14 October 2025 with an exhibition by Chinese artist Duan Jianyu.
